Key Properties:
-
Wide pH Range: The paper is designed to measure pH levels from 1 to 14, where 1-6 indicates acidic conditions, 7 is neutral, and 8-14 indicates alkaline or basic conditions.
-
Color Change: The paper changes to different colors based on the pH level of the solution. For example, it may turn red for strong acids and blue/green for bases.
-
Easy to Use: It is typically sold in rolls or strips, allowing it to be easily dipped into liquids or used to test solid substances by moistening them.
-
Rapid Results: Provides quick color changes, making it an efficient tool for immediate pH readings.
Uses:
-
Laboratories: Commonly used in chemistry and biology labs to measure the pH of solutions.
-
Classroom Demonstrations: Ideal for teaching students about acid-base chemistry and the concept of pH.
-
Water Testing: Used for testing the pH levels of water in environmental studies, aquariums, and water quality analysis.
-
Field Testing: Handy for quick pH testing in outdoor settings or when other instruments are unavailable.
